Summary

The television program "48 Hours" features investigative reporting on true crime cases, including interviews with key figures and examination of evidence. Award-winning correspondents such as Erin Moriarty and Peter Van Sant contribute to the show's coverage, which has led to the exoneration of wrongly convicted individuals and the reopening of cold cases. The show has received numerous awards, including multiple Peabodys and Emmys. A new season of "48 Hours" is set to premiere on October 10, 2026.
